Report: EU copyright rules are maladapted to the increase of cross-border cultural exchange on the web

30 January 2015

 

by Julia Reda

Member of the European Parliament

Europe would benefit from a copyright that promotes creativity not just by locking up past creations, but by broadly encouraging future creation and unlocking a pan-European cultural market.

"Although the directive was meant to adapt copyright to the digital age, in reality it is blocking the exchange of knowledge and culture across borders today."
